Have always enjoyed reading and was thrilled to discover this group of people who also love reading. I am compulsive about reading the New Yorker, a weekly magazine, which takes a lot of my time. Now I feel conflicted because I want to read more books but I don't want to stop reading newspapers and magazines. I am a member of a book discussion group at my local library.

I am the daughter of a book collector and much as I loved all of his books, it concerns me that books have taken over his home. He can't move or find room for his other possessions because of all of his books. The thought of passing books on after reading them appeals to me. I've always thought of books as being like friends.

I also love films, music and theatre. In fact, I have done a better job with seeing movies than reading books lately. I view bookcrossing as a clever idea and an opportunity to meet others who like to exercise their brains.
